The Portuguese driving license test includes 2 primary parts: the theoretical test and the useful test.
1. Theoretical Exam
The theoretical test assesses prospects' understanding of traffic laws, roadway indications, and safe driving practices. It normally includes multiple-choice concerns. Important aspects of the theoretical exam consist of:
AspectDetailsVariety of Questions30 questionsPassing ScoreMinimum 28 appropriate responsesPeriod30 minutesFormatMultiple-choice2. Practical Exam
When candidates pass the theoretical test, they can set up the practical test. This test evaluates real-world driving abilities and understanding of automobile handling. Key aspects of the practical test include:

A: The duration varies, however on average, it can take several weeks to a couple of months, depending on how quickly prospects can complete their training and pass the examinations.
Q2: What should I expect on the practical driving test?
A: Candidates should be prepared to demonstrate various driving maneuvers, including city driving, highway driving, and particular abilities like parking and emergency stops.
Q3: Can I take the examinations in English?
A: Yes, the theoretical exam can be taken in numerous languages, consisting of English, however it's suggested to verify with your driving school.
Q4: What happens if I stop working the exam?
A: If you stop working the theoretical test, you can retake it after a period, while the useful exam may also have particular retake rules. Constantly inspect with your driving school for information.
Q5: Is a medical examination needed?
A: Yes, a medical examination is compulsory to ensure candidates are fit to drive.
